Originally Posted by MARO4LYFE
love your setup,do you have any clearane issues and what kind of mufflers are you using
They look like the MagnaFlow 4"x9" case stainless mufflers...They are a good choice for flow and clearance...Another good one is the Edelbrock 304 SDTs measuring 3 5/8"x10"...
